Skyline JV vs. Garfield JV Skyline HS Tuesday 5/4/2010 Skyline 9 Garfield 3
Game Summary: The Skyline JV team ended their season with a game of solid team pitching, solid team defense, and timely hitting for a 9-3 win. Garfield struck early with 2 runs in the first, but Skyline immediately answered with 3 of our own, taking the lead on consecutive singles by Jordan Cardwell and Michael Ishii. The game stayed at 3-2 until the Spartans scored 5 in the bottom of four for an 8-2 lead on a double by Austin Nutt, singles by Matt Dompier and Michael Stewart, and a triple by Brandon Fischer. Four Spartan pitchers backed by errorless fielding defense combined to limit Garfield to 4 hits during the contest.
Pitching Summary: Eric Thies 2IP, 2ER, 2H, 1BB, 1HP; Matt Lunde 2IP, 1H, 2K’s, 2BB; Brandon Lundeberg 1IP, 1K; Ryan Parks 2IP, 1ER, 1H, 3BB.
Hitting Summary: Michael Stewart 2-3, 3B, R, RBI; Michael Ishii 2-4, R, 2RBI; Jordan Cardwell 2-4, R, 2B. RBI; Brandon Fischer 1-3, 3B, R, RBI; Austin Nutt 1-3, 2B, R. Also with hits: Ian Smith, Joe Beattie, Matt Dompier

4/28/2010 Skyline JV vs. Issaquah JV Issaquah HS Wednesday 4/28/2010 Issaquah 8 Skyline 2 Game Summary: Unfortunately, Issaquah Eagles starting pitcher Brandon Mahovlich celebrated his 16th birthday with quite a day against the Spartans. Mahovlich delivered the big blow in the bottom of the first with a 3 run HR and his 107 pitch effort over six innings held the Spartan offense in check allowing 2ER on 4 hits, with 7K’s and 4BBs. Skyline scored their 2 runs in the third inning on a 1 out triple by Connor Gilchrist, who eventually scored on a wild pitch, and singles by Clayton Huber and Joe Beattie. Pitching Summary: Brandon Lundeberg 3IP, 5ER, 4H, 2K, 3BB; Ryan Parks 3IP, 0ER, 2H, 1K, 3BB. Hitting Summary: Connor Gilchrist 2-4, 3B, 1R; Clayton Huber 1-2, 1R; Joe Beattie 1-2, RBI. 4/26/2010 Skyline JV vs Newport JV Skyline HS Monday 4/26/2010 Newport 5 Skyline 4 Game Summary: Threatened by a rainstorm on a Monday afternoon, Skyline hosted Newport for the second game between the two teams this season. The first game was a disappointing loss for the Spartans as a 1-1 game turned into a 7-1 loss in a game Skyline gave away when they gave up 6 runs in the bottom of the 6th inning. Hopes to send the Knights home with a loss were dashed on another day where fielding errors played a large part in the outcome of the game. Skyline starting pitcher, Matt Lunde was dominant early striking out the side in 3 of the first 4 innings and totaled 10 K’s in 4.1 innings pitched. Newport’s starter matched Lunde with zero’s for the first 3 innings when Newport took a 1-0 lead in the top of the 4th on an unearned run. Skyline managed their own unearned run in the bottom of the fourth to even the score but failed to score more than the single run after loading the bases with no outs. The fifth inning saw the offenses chase each of the starters with Newport scoring 4 runs, 2 of them unearned taking a 5-1 lead. Skyline returned fire in their half of the fifth with 3 runs of their own. Jordan Cardwell came on in relief of Lunde and held the Knights scoreless for the remainder of the game but the Spartan offense could not find a way to score against the Newport reliever.
